Age of 18 -75 years; Full awareness and ability to communicate; Without history of coronary angiography and Using reflexology; Absence of relaxation and Psychotherapy episodes; Absence of effective psychiatric medication according of the patient statements and material in file; Heart rate above the 60 beats per minute ; systolic blood pressure above the 90 mm Hg; Temperature of 36.5 ° -37.5 ° C; Not arrhythmia ; Absence of addiction to drugs and alcohol according to file; Absence employment in medical treatment; Absence of fractures; wounds and skin problems in the areas of massage.
exclusion criteria: Patient's dissatisfaction to participate in research;Cardiopulmonary resuscitation ; Cancellation angiography during the study;Creates Chest pain and dyspnoea

- Primary Outcome Measures
Name Time Method Anxiety and- physiological parameters. Timepoint: 10 minutes before of the intervention-Immediately -half an hour after the procedure. Method of measurement: Hospital Anxiety Questionnaire-Measure blood pressure in millimeters of o mercury by using mercury manometers-Temperature in degrees Celsius by using mercury thermometer-Pulse and respiratory rate counting is based on the number of minutes in one minute using an analog clock complete.
